Either side can ask for an administrative review of the decision within 1 month of the filing. This is done by applying in writing for Board testimonial.
The panel may affirm, modify or rescind the decision, or bring back the situation to the schedule for additional growth of the document. In the event the panel choice is not consentaneous, any kind of interested party may apply in composing for a necessary review by the complete Board. You can likewise appeal your situation at the very same time to the New york city State Supreme Court, Appellate Department, 3rd Judicial Division.

Everyone hopes that their employees' comp case goes smoothly, however either side can appeal the choice in composing within 30 days of the choice. 3 Board members review appealed situations.
There is no time at all limit on issuing a decision, however it's in your benefits to seek a charm asap. Either side may look for administrative evaluation of the decision made by the Workers' Compensation Board panel within 1 month of the declaring of the decision. This is done by using in creating for Board evaluation.
Appeals of Board Panel decisions might be taken to the Appellate Division, Third Judicial Department, High Court of the State of New York, within one month. The decision of the Appellate Department might be interested the Court of Appeals. After a hearing, if either side disagrees with the decision, numerous lawful choices are offered.

Employees' payment is covered by insurance coverage. Insurance policy protection for workers' payment should come from your employer.
In other states that do permit waivers, the staff member and employer might agree by agreement when the employee is hired to abandon their employees' settlement insurance policy. If the Department of Industrial Accidents (DIA) uncovers that an employer does not have workers' payment insurance policy for its staff members and has not gotten an exemption, they will provide a "Quit working Order" until the employer enters into compliance with the regulation.
The law in Boston generally blocks damaged workers from suing their employer for injuries. You are normally called for to go via your company's insurance coverage provider and claim worker's payment.
The reality that the crash occurred while you got on the work is enough for protection. On the other hand, an injury claim needs proof of mistake, which can be difficult. In the unusual occasion that you in fact can sue your employer for a crash, you would need to show that the accident was no accident in any way.
However, these limitations only use in situations where there is no fault designated for an accident or where the company was at mistake. If an additional entity that was not your company negligently or recklessly created your injuries, you still have the ability to sue them. If a professional was accountable for developing scaffolding on your site that was put incorrectly and collapsed, you might have a situation versus the contractor.
